Can water-damaged Samsung galaxy A23 5G be fixed?
Yes, the water-damaged Samsung is fixed, and here are the five steps to fix your A23 5G touch screen not working after water damage:

Turn Off the Samsung Galaxy A23 5G Phone Instantly:
The first thing you have to do to fix your Samsung Galaxy A23 5G Not Working Water Damage is to NOT use your Samsung Galaxy A23 5G phone.
Do not try or attempt to turn on your phone or press the power button. And if your phone is powered on turn it off without doing any other actions.
Because of the Samsung Galaxy A23, 5G is powered and wet, you may make a short circuit and therefore toast the mobile phone.
Avoid Charging your water Harmed Samsung Galaxy A23 5G:
To avoid damaging your often or even risking it exploding, do not try to charge your phone especially if your phone is submerged in water in a pool, or even falls into the toilet bowl.
It will cause both the phone and the charger to be damaged.
As we advised you not to turn on the phone just after the water contact, we strongly recommend you NEVER try to charge the device as that will damage both the charger and the phone due to a short circuit.
Usually, if there is a short circuit somewhere, the Samsung Galaxy A23 5G and the charger heat up causing damage or even exploding.
Dry the Samsung Galaxy A23 5G:
Open your Samsung galaxy A23 5G cover and remove both the SIM card and memory card. And bring a soft towel and dry it behind.

Do Not Use A Hairdryer With Your Samsung A23 5G :
The most essential thing to Fix the Samsung A23 5GTouchscreen Not Working Water Damage is to not use a hairdryer to dry out the phone.
Because water, when trapped inside can’t escape after vaporizing only. Usually dismantling will be done before operating hot air.
and the dryer won’t remove moisture from the inside. And the hot air can also harm your camera in addition to the phone itself.
So do not try to use a hairdryer at all!
Change Your Phone Touchscreen:
If the above solutions do not work with your Samsung galaxy A23 5G.
Then Your phone may need to change the touchscreen as the electrical circuit under the screen may get burned. go to your nearest phone repair and ask for touchscreen repair.

How do I know if my Samsung A23 5G has water damage?
You will find your phone not working correctly. and this will be mostly shown on the touch screen. The touch screen is the easiest part to be affected by water damage. as it will glitch, and the touch screen will not work. or your touchscreen will be black.
Is Samsung A23 5G waterproof?
Samsung A23 5G is not waterproof and can easily be damaged by water. But you can buy a waterproof cover to avoid water accidents
